黑狐家游戏

微软官方虚拟机,微软的虚拟机是什么

欧气 3 0

本文目录导读:

  1. 微软虚拟机概述
  2. 微软虚拟机的功能
  3. 微软虚拟机的应用场景
  4. 微软虚拟机的优势

《深入解析微软虚拟机:功能、应用与优势》

微软虚拟机概述

微软的虚拟机是一种强大的虚拟化技术,它允许用户在一台物理计算机上创建和运行多个虚拟的操作系统环境,Hyper - V是微软最具代表性的虚拟机产品。

(一)Hyper - V的架构

Hyper - V基于一种微内核的架构设计,它将虚拟机监控程序(Hypervisor)直接运行在物理计算机的硬件之上,这种方式能够高效地管理硬件资源并分配给各个虚拟机,Hyper - V将物理计算机的硬件资源,如CPU、内存、磁盘和网络等进行抽象化处理,使得每个虚拟机都能独立地使用这些资源,就好像它们是运行在独立的物理机器上一样。

微软官方虚拟机,微软的虚拟机是什么

图片来源于网络,如有侵权联系删除

(二)与操作系统的集成

Hyper - V与Windows Server操作系统紧密集成,在Windows Server操作系统中,用户可以方便地通过图形界面或命令行工具来管理Hyper - V虚拟机,在Windows Server 2019中,系统管理员可以轻松地创建新的虚拟机、配置虚拟机的硬件资源(如分配CPU核心数量、内存大小等)、安装操作系统以及管理虚拟机的网络连接等操作,Hyper - V也支持与Windows桌面操作系统(如Windows 10专业版、企业版等)的集成,用户可以在自己的桌面计算机上创建和运行虚拟机,用于测试软件、开发环境搭建等目的。

微软虚拟机的功能

(一)灵活的资源分配

1、CPU资源分配

- 微软虚拟机允许用户精确地控制每个虚拟机所使用的CPU资源,可以为虚拟机分配特定数量的CPU核心,并且还能设置CPU使用率的限制,在一个多任务的企业环境中,对于一些不太重要的测试虚拟机,可以限制其CPU使用率在较低水平,以确保关键业务虚拟机能够获得足够的CPU资源来高效运行。

2、内存分配

- 系统管理员可以根据虚拟机的需求为其分配不同大小的内存,在创建虚拟机时,可以指定初始的内存大小,并且在虚拟机运行过程中,还可以根据实际情况动态地调整内存分配,这对于应对不同类型的工作负载非常有用,比如对于一个运行小型数据库应用的虚拟机,可能只需要分配较少的内存,而对于运行大型企业级应用的虚拟机,则需要分配更多的内存。

(二)多种存储选项

1、虚拟硬盘(VHD和VHDX)

- 微软虚拟机支持使用虚拟硬盘(VHD和VHDX格式)来存储虚拟机的操作系统、应用程序和数据,VHDX是VHD的升级版,它具有更高的性能和更大的存储容量支持,用户可以创建不同类型的虚拟硬盘,如固定大小的虚拟硬盘(在创建时就确定其大小,占用固定的物理磁盘空间)和动态扩展的虚拟硬盘(初始占用较小的物理磁盘空间,随着数据的写入而自动扩展)。

2、存储迁移

- Hyper - V提供了存储迁移功能,这意味着可以在不中断虚拟机运行的情况下,将虚拟机的存储从一个物理存储位置迁移到另一个位置,当企业需要对存储设备进行升级或维护时,可以利用存储迁移功能将虚拟机的存储从旧的磁盘阵列迁移到新的高性能存储系统中,从而提高虚拟机的性能和可靠性。

(三)网络功能

1、虚拟网络交换机

- 微软虚拟机中的Hyper - V支持创建虚拟网络交换机,虚拟网络交换机可以将虚拟机连接到不同的网络环境中,如内部网络、外部网络(连接到物理网络)或者是仅虚拟机之间相互通信的专用网络,通过创建虚拟网络交换机,用户可以灵活地配置虚拟机的网络连接,满足不同的网络需求,在企业的测试环境中,可以创建一个内部网络的虚拟网络交换机,使得测试虚拟机只能在内部网络中相互通信,从而保证测试环境的安全性和独立性。

2、网络负载均衡

- Hyper - V还支持网络负载均衡功能,当有多个虚拟机提供相同的网络服务(如Web服务)时,可以利用网络负载均衡将外部网络请求均匀地分配到这些虚拟机上,提高服务的可用性和性能,这对于企业的高流量Web应用等场景非常重要,可以避免单个虚拟机因负载过高而出现性能问题。

微软官方虚拟机,微软的虚拟机是什么

图片来源于网络,如有侵权联系删除

微软虚拟机的应用场景

(一)企业数据中心

1、服务器整合

- 在企业数据中心中,微软虚拟机可以用于服务器整合,通过将多个物理服务器上的应用和服务迁移到虚拟机中,并在少数几台物理服务器上运行这些虚拟机,可以大大减少物理服务器的数量,降低硬件成本、能源消耗和数据中心的占地面积,一家企业原本有10台物理服务器分别运行不同的业务应用,通过使用Hyper - V虚拟机,可以将这些应用整合到3 - 4台物理服务器上的虚拟机中运行。

2、灾难恢复与业务连续性

- 虚拟机可以方便地进行备份和恢复操作,企业可以定期对虚拟机进行快照备份,当发生硬件故障、软件故障或者自然灾害等情况时,可以快速地从备份中恢复虚拟机,确保业务的连续性,还可以利用Hyper - V的复制功能,将虚拟机从一个数据中心复制到另一个数据中心,实现异地灾难恢复解决方案。

(二)软件开发与测试

1、开发环境隔离

- 在软件开发过程中,不同的项目可能需要不同的开发环境,包括不同版本的操作系统、开发工具和数据库等,微软虚拟机可以为每个项目创建独立的虚拟机开发环境,这样可以避免不同项目之间的环境冲突,一个开发团队同时进行多个项目,一个项目需要在Windows Server 2016环境下开发,另一个项目需要在Windows 10环境下开发,通过创建对应的虚拟机,开发人员可以轻松地在同一台物理计算机上切换不同的开发环境。

2、软件测试

- 对于软件测试来说,虚拟机提供了一个理想的测试平台,测试人员可以在虚拟机中安装不同的操作系统版本、配置各种软件环境来测试软件的兼容性,由于虚拟机可以方便地进行克隆和恢复操作,测试人员可以快速地重置测试环境,进行多次重复测试,提高测试效率。

(三)教育与培训

1、安全的学习环境

- 在教育和培训领域,微软虚拟机可以为学生和学员提供安全的学习环境,在计算机网络课程的教学中,教师可以在虚拟机中创建各种网络拓扑结构,让学生在虚拟机环境中进行网络配置、故障排除等实验操作,这样可以避免学生在真实网络环境中操作可能带来的风险,同时也方便教师管理和控制学习环境。

2、多操作系统学习

- 学生可以通过虚拟机轻松地学习不同的操作系统,他们可以在一台物理计算机上安装多个虚拟机,分别运行Windows、Linux等不同的操作系统,从而深入了解不同操作系统的特点、功能和操作方法。

微软虚拟机的优势

(一)与微软生态系统的兼容性

1、与Windows应用的无缝集成

微软官方虚拟机,微软的虚拟机是什么

图片来源于网络,如有侵权联系删除

- 由于微软虚拟机与Windows操作系统紧密集成,它能够与各种Windows应用实现无缝集成,这意味着企业在使用微软虚拟机运行Windows应用时,不需要进行额外的复杂配置,企业内部的办公软件(如Microsoft Office)、企业资源规划(ERP)软件等在虚拟机中的运行效果与在物理机上运行基本相同,而且可以方便地与其他Windows服务器和客户端进行交互。

2、与微软管理工具的协同工作

- 微软虚拟机可以与微软的各种管理工具协同工作,如System Center,System Center可以对企业中的大量Hyper - V虚拟机进行集中管理,包括虚拟机的部署、监控、性能优化等操作,这种协同工作能力使得企业的IT管理更加高效和便捷,可以大大减少管理成本和提高管理效率。

(二)性能优化

1、动态内存管理优化

- Hyper - V的动态内存管理功能可以根据虚拟机的实际内存需求自动调整内存分配,这一优化措施可以提高物理服务器的内存利用率,减少内存资源的浪费,在一个有多台虚拟机运行的物理服务器上,当某些虚拟机处于空闲状态时,Hyper - V可以自动回收这些虚拟机多余的内存,并分配给其他需要更多内存的虚拟机,从而提高整个服务器的性能。

2、存储性能优化

- 微软虚拟机通过对虚拟硬盘(VHDX)的优化,提高了存储性能,VHDX格式支持更大的块大小和更高的磁盘I/O性能,Hyper - V还支持存储分层等技术,可以将经常访问的数据存储在高性能的存储介质(如固态硬盘)上,而将不经常访问的数据存储在较低成本的存储介质(如机械硬盘)上,从而提高整体的存储效率和性能。

(三)安全性

1、虚拟机隔离

- 微软虚拟机通过虚拟机监控程序(Hypervisor)实现了虚拟机之间的严格隔离,每个虚拟机都运行在自己独立的虚拟环境中,即使一个虚拟机受到攻击或出现故障,也不会影响到其他虚拟机的运行,这种隔离机制为企业的多租户环境、不同业务应用的运行提供了安全保障。

2、安全功能集成

- Hyper - V集成了多种安全功能,如虚拟机的加密、安全启动等,虚拟机的加密功能可以保护虚拟机中的数据在存储和传输过程中的安全性,安全启动则可以确保虚拟机启动时加载的是经过验证的操作系统和驱动程序,防止恶意软件在虚拟机启动阶段入侵。

微软的虚拟机,特别是Hyper - V,凭借其丰富的功能、广泛的应用场景以及诸多优势,在企业、教育、软件开发等众多领域发挥着重要的作用,为用户提供了高效、灵活、安全的虚拟化解决方案。

黑狐家游戏
  • 评论列表

留言评论